Misato, Sunday 2nd,
The first Sunday of December was blessed by beautiful weather, and was to hold the awaited clash in Division 2 between 2 unbeaten teams, Lions, with a 100% record, and Maritizio, unbeaten in 4 games.
Lions lined up with their full squad, whilst Maritizio although looking strong, did have a guest keeper from Vags between the posts.
Maritizio started the game strongly, and showed they meant business by notching the first attempt on goal via a powerful header from their tall striker, from the edge of the box, but not troubling Lions' safe hands, Orlando (aka Spiderman).
Lions' young lads combination upfront proved lethal about 10 minutes into the game, when Maritizio's keeper, Taylor, could only parry a shot, and as he burrowed to keep the ball in control, Lion's striker Ken Hersche used his body well to shield the ball, pass it calmly to the edge of the box, for Omar (Golden Boy), who calmy slotted into the bottom right corner (slight deflection).
20 minutes later, AbuBakr weaved his way through the left side, and placed the ball beyond the keeper, but Ken was at the far post to place the ball into an empty net.
Henry (from KanoCelts) came on for Maritizio, and did look like causing a few problems, but Gaafar Somi took full responsibility of the midfield and made sure Martizio were limited to long (usually blocked) attempts.
Maritizio's left winger Tim, tried hard, but his crosses only fell to Orlando.
With 5 minutes to go in the first half, some good play saw Zuhair through on the right, and as he chipped Taylor, everybody wondered, why did Zuhair place the ball so far to the other side and not on target...but out of nowhere came AbuBakr (apparently only Zuhair saw him)...diving low to head the ball in at the far post for Lions' 3rd.
One or 2 more chances fell to Lions, but Maritizio fought well to keep the ball out and limit the score to 3-0.
The second half saw Lions rest Zuhair, and putting on the pacey Ahmed Gaafar upfront. Within a few seconds from kick-off, a misplaced pass by Lions saw Maritizio break into the box, but an amazing dash and save from Orlando denied Maritizio a definete goal. This shows how both teams played, 1 misplaced pass could end up in the net!
Half way through the second half, Ahmed Gaafar dashed down the left wing past 2 players, but Taylor rushed out and pushed the ball to a corner. Gaafar Somi rose at the near post to head in the 4th for Lions.
5 minutes later, a rash tackle saw Maritizio fairly awarded a penalty.
Orlando is determined to keep a clean sheet, but having been out all night and having no sleep at all the night before, he had to rely on his adrenalin rush (well and the red bull)....and as the Maritizio player took the penalty, Orlando made a great save, but a Maritizio player followed up and put the ball in the net. Orlando was so mad at the Lions defence, but luckily, and fairly, the referee asked for a retake, becasue the Maritizio players rushed into the box before the penalty was taken.
The same player stepped up, and guess what? Orlando saved again!! This time making sure he parried the ball sideways!
With 10 minutes to go, Omar put a brilliant ball, bisecting the Maritizio defence, and Tatsuya (Conejo) outpaced all, but his ball across fell to a Maritizio defender who hoofed the ball away.
Maritizio threatened and 2 back to back clearnace on the near nad far posts by Ken and Mo Birkia, kept the score at 4-0. Another chance fell to Maritizio and a great block 7 yards out by Zuhair (then on as a defender) saved a possible goal.
With a few minutes to go, Omar saved the best for last, when he struck a beautiful 30-yarder, only to see Taylor backpaddling helplessly as the ball hit the back of the net to make it 5-0 to Lions.
Biggest win for Lions, against a strong Maritizio, unbeaten, in a 6-pointer!
Lions were on form, every player on the pitch battled (especially Baghir), and the referee Jorge Kuriyama, who pleaded for some entertaining football before the game, not only refereed well, but witnessed one of the games of the season.
